| Aspect | Home Based Virtual Appointment Setter | Customer Service Representative |
|---|
| Credentials | Basic computer skills, communication skills | Same as appointment setter, often with additional product knowledge |
| Work Environment | Remote, home-based | Remote or in-office, depending on employer |
| Industry Usage | Sales, marketing, lead generation | Customer support, client relations |
| Primary Focus | Scheduling appointments, lead qualification | Handling customer inquiries, resolving issues |
While both roles often require strong communication skills and remote work setups, the Home Based Virtual Appointment Setter primarily focuses on scheduling and lead qualification, whereas the Customer Service Representative handles customer inquiries and support. Understanding these differences helps job seekers find the right position aligned with their skills and career goals.
